CRANBERRY-APPLE PIE SQUARES
Combine two holiday fruit favorites in this inviting pie, with a basic crust and a special caramel and ice cream topping.
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Dessert
Time 2h40m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 17
Steps:
- Heat oven to 375°F. In large bowl, combine 1 1/2 cups flour, sugar and 1/4 teaspoon salt; mix well. With pastry blender, cut in 1/2 cup but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
- In small bowl, combine egg yolk and milk; beat well. Add to flour mixture; stir just until dry ingredients are moistened.
- On lightly floured surface, roll dough to form 15x11-inch rectangle. Place in ungreased 13x9-inch pan. Press in bottom and 1 inch up sides of pan.
- Place apples in large microwave-safe bowl. Microwave on HIGH for 6 to 8 minutes, stirring every 2 minutes, or until apples are fork-tender. Add 1 cup sugar, 1/4 cup flour, cinnamon and 1/2 teaspoon salt; mix well. Spoon apple mixture over crust. Sprinkle with cranberries.
- In medium bowl, combine 1 cup flour, brown sugar and 1/2 cup butter; mix until crumbly. Sprinkle over fruit.
- Bake at 375°F. for 45 to 60 minutes or until topping is deep golden brown, apples are tender and filling is bubbly. Cool 1 hour.
- To serve, cut warm dessert into squares; place on individual dessert plates. Top each with caramel topping and ice cream.

APPLE-CRANBERRY CRISP
A wonderful combination of apples and fresh cranberries with a crisp, pecan topping.
Provided by PATTON0626
Categories Desserts Fruit Dessert Recipes Cranberry Dessert Recipes
Time 1h
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C.) Butter an 8 inch square baking dish.
- In a large bowl, mix together apples, cranberries, white sugar, cinnamon and nutmeg. Place evenly into baking dish.
- In the same bowl, combine oats, flour and brown sugar. With a fork, mix in butter until crumbly. Stir in pecans. Sprinkle over apples.
- Bake in preheated oven for 40 to 50 minutes, or until topping is golden brown, and apples are tender.

APPLE CRANBERRY SQUARES
Easy homemade apple-cranberry fruit squares bursting with Fall flavor. A fun seasonal dessert.
Provided by Rachel
Categories Dessert
Time 1h5m
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F. If serving from the pan, grease a square baking pan, with baking spray, butter or shortening.If attempting to remove and cut into slices outside of the pan, line baking pan with foil or parchment.
- In a food processor, toss in all crust ingredients except for apple cider and the egg white. Blend until fine. Remove 1 cup of dry crust ingredients to use as the topping. Add the egg white and apple cider to food processor, blend until moist. Transfer mixture to baking pan. Pat down into a fairly flat layer. Bake bottom crust for 10 minutes.
- Add cranberries, apple cider and 1/2 cup white sugar to a small saucepan. Cook over medium high heat, stirring frequently until bubbly and all cranberries have burst. Add flour, mix well. Allow cranberry mixture to thicken. Remove from heat.
- Peel 2 baking apples and slice into bite size pieces. Toss in a medium bowl, sprinkle with remaining sugar and cinnamon. Toss apples to coat.
- Pour cranberry mixture over sliced apples. Stir gently to coat apples completely.
- Pour apple cranberry mixture over baked crust. Top off with remaining dry crust ingredients. Gently pat into an even layer.
- Bake for 45 minutes. Let cool for at least 20 minutes, toss in the fridge for several hours to make slicing easier. Store in an airtight container for up to several days.
EASY APPLE CRANBERRY CRISP
If you love cranberries and apples, you have to try this Easy Apple Cranberry Crisp! Featuring juicy apples, tart cranberries, and a buttery oat crumble topping! Use fresh cranberries or frozen cranberries... both work great! Perfect for Thanksgiving or Christmas dessert!
Provided by Ashley Manila
Categories Dessert
Time 1h10m
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ees (F). Lightly grease a 9x13-inch baking dish with butter.
- Place the sliced apples and cranberries in a large bowl and toss with the orange juice and zest.
- Sprinkle the flour, sugars, and spices on top of the fruit and toss well to coat.
- Pour fruit mixture into prepared baking dish and set aside while you make the crumb topping.
- In a large bowl, combine the oats, both sugars, cinnamon and flour. Add in the cubed butter and, using two forks or a pastry blender, cut the butter into the dry ingredients until mixture resembles a coarse meal.
- Sprinkle the topping evenly over the fruit mixture.
- Place the pan in the oven and bake for 55 to 60 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and the fruit is bubbling.
- Remove from the oven and place the pan on a cooling rack. Serve warm! Preferably with ice cream.

EASY APPLE CHEESECAKE BARS
Easy Apple Cheesecake Bars are a delicious fall dessert made with crescent rolls, cream cheese, fresh apples and buttery cinnamon sugar topping. Save your leftovers, and turn these apple dessert bars into breakfast bars!
Provided by Vera Zecevic
Categories Dessert
Time 50m
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375F. Grease 8 x 8 inch baking dish with non-stick spray, set aside.
- To make the cheesecake filling beat together cream cheese, ½ cup sugar and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y, set aside.
- To make apple pie filling stir together diced apples, ¼ cup sugar, cinnamon, nutmeg and cornstarch, until evenly coated, set aside.
- Unroll crescent rolls and cut in two halves. Place 1 half of dough (4 crescents) at the bottom of baking dish. Pinch together the perforation and stretch the dough to make the bottom crust.
- Spread cheesecake filling and smooth the top. Drain any excess of juice from the apple filling and
- scatter diced apples over cheesecake filling.
- On a sheet of baking paper spread remaining dough, seal the perforation and stretch to create the top crust. Invert the crust over apples.
- Pour melted butter and spread on top of the crust. Sprinkle with cinnamon sugar.
- Bake for about 35 minutes. Tent the top with aluminum foil if it starts to brown too quickly.
- Cool completely before slicing and serving.
- Store leftovers in the fridge.

CRANBERRY CRUMBLE BARS RECIPE
Need a quick breakfast solution? These cranberry crumble bars are perfect to grab on your way out the door. Prepare them quickly and easily.
Provided by Becky Hardin - Easy Dessert Recipes
Categories Dessert
Time 1h5m
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ease a 9x13-inch baking pan with nonstick spray. Set aside.
- Using a hand mixer, beat the butter and brown sugar together until light and fluffy.
- Add the egg yolks and vanilla extract, beating to combine.
- In a separate bowl, mix the flour and salt together.
- Add the flour mixture to the wet ingredients until combined. The dough will be slightly crumbly.
- Divide the dough into thirds.
- Spread ⅔ of the dough in the bottom of the prepared 9x13-inch pan. Press until the dough lays flat and even along the sides. Bake for 25 minutes.
- While the dough bakes, fold the chocolate chips and nuts into the remaining ⅓ of the dough.
- Take the pan out of the oven and evenly spread a whole bag of cranberries over the dough, to the edges.
- Quickly and evenly, put approximately 1-inch pieces of the remaining dough mixture on top of the baked dough and cranberries.
- Put the pan back in the oven and bake for another 20 minutes.
- Cover the pan loosely with aluminum foil and continue baking for another approximately 10 minutes, until it's cooked through. The top should be golden brown and the cranberries should be bubbly.
- Let the bars cool for a few minutes before cutting. The bars can be served warm or cold.
